The tx750 is a beautiful bike, unfortunately the engine design wasn’t great. Oiling issues, chain drive balancer, and the exhaust balancer all made it a problem bike. However, it’s rare and because of that, I love it!

Yep, the first A models usually blew up during the Warranty period! Yamaha fixed all the problems with the next year's B model. It was very reliable, if not that fast. But the bike had got such a bad reputation dealers could not sell them! It disappeared after only 2-years production. A B-model runner is rare and is a collector's item nowadays.
